5 Mayo Drive, Sunderland, SR3 2QT is a leasehold detached property built between 1967-1975. The property offers approximately 743 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£268,539 , which equates to approximately £362 per square foot. It was last sold on 22 Feb 2019 for £203,000. Since then, the value has increased by £65,539, representing a 32.3% increase, or approximately 4.7% per year.

The current estimated value of £268,539 is:

  • 19.4% higher than the average property price on Mayo Drive
  • 25.6% higher than the average in the SR3 2QT postcode area
  • and 49.2% higher than the average price for Sunderland as a whole

Based on EPC inspection history, this property has been mostly owner-occupied (3 out of 3 inspections). This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 4 July 2018,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

5 Mayo Drive, Sunderland, Tyne And Wear, SR3 2QT has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 4 Jul 2018.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 8 Jul 2016. The rating of E rem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 6.7%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ation (assumed) to pitched, 250 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The wall energy efficiency changing from good to average, with the construction or insulation remaining cavity wall, filled cavity.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 91% of fixed outlets to no low energy lighting, with efficiency changing from very good to very poor.
